    The Love, YEG Show - If #YEG could talk, Sherri Beauchamp & Jessie McCracken believe these are the stories it would tell about the people, places & passion in Edmonton. Love, YEG is dedicated to people who are making a difference in their community. There’s so much good happening, and they want to share it with you! Subscribe to be inspired weekly.

    e76 - Jacek Chocolate Coture

    e76 - Jacek Chocolate Coture
    What a treat it was speaking with Jacqueline of Jacek Chocolate Couture. She wants to be known as a Coconista and it shows in the work that she and her team do every day. Her artisanal chocolates are stunning and taste amazing. How lucky we are in the city of Edmonton to have Jacek Chocolate and not just for their sweets but also for their philanthropic giving.
